The ATN BlazeSeeker-207 features a 256x192 thermal sensor with 12μm pixel size and <35mK NETD rating for superior sensitivity to temperature variations. You're getting multiple viewing modes with five color palettes (White Hot, Black Hot, Iron Red, Alarm, Sepia, and Green Hot) for customized thermal imaging.
Built-in video recording and photo capture capabilities store to microSD cards up to 256GB. Wireless connectivity via built-in Wi-Fi allows smartphone app control for adjusting settings and capturing media directly from your phone.
The 1-8.8x magnification provides flexible detection range up to 345 meters.

At 256x192 resolution, this isn't the highest-resolution thermal imager on the market - premium models offer 640x480 or higher for finer detail. The 50Hz refresh rate is adequate for most hunting scenarios but may show slight lag during rapid panning compared to higher-end 60Hz units.
